>>> On 24.01.13 at 02:17, "K. Y. Srinivasan" <kys at microsoft.com> wrote:
> @@ -69,6 +74,11 @@ static void __init ms_hyperv_init_platform(void)
>  	       ms_hyperv.features, ms_hyperv.hints);
>  
>  	clocksource_register_hz(&hyperv_cs, NSEC_PER_SEC/100);
> +
> +	/*
> +	 * Setup the IDT for hypervisor callback.
> +	 */
> +	alloc_intr_gate(HYPERVISOR_CALLBACK_VECTOR, hyperv_callback_vector);

Isn't doing this unconditionally here as problematic as the call to
clocksource_register_hz() turned out to be when Xen's Hyper-V
shim reacts to the CPUID inquiry above?
